Published on: June 2026
ONLINE EXAMINATION SYSTEM USING DJANGO
Mahaprasad Rout Shubham Kumar Sahoo
Shubhendu Sekhar Sahoo
GIFT Autonomous, Bhubaneswar, Odisha, India
Article Status
Available Documents
Abstract
It provides dedicated interfaces for administrators, teachers, and students, enabling user registration, teacher approval, student approval, question bank management, online examination scheduling, answer submission, automatic evaluation, result processing, and report generation.
The application is implemented using Python and Django on the backend, HTML, CSS, JavaScript, and Bootstrap on the frontend, and SQLite or MySQL as the relational database. Django's Model-View-Template architecture, Object Relational Mapper, authentication middleware, password hashing, CSRF protection, and session handling provide a reliable foundation for secure academic assessment.
The proposed system improves accuracy, reduces operational cost, supports faster result publication, and creates a centralized platform for digital examination management. This report presents the design, methodology, database schema, implementation details, testing strategy, security mechanisms, advantages, future enhancements, and references for the proposed system in IEEE-style format.
Keywords--Online Examination System, Django Framework, Python, SQLite, MySQL, HTML, CSS, JavaScript, Bootstrap, MVT Architecture, Automatic Evaluation, Digital Assessment, Web Application Security.
How to Cite this Paper
Rout, M. & Sahoo, S. K. (2026). Online Examination System Using Django. International Journal of Creative and Open Research in Engineering and Management, <i>02</i>(6). https://doi.org/10.55041/ijcope.v2i6.085
Rout, Mahaprasad, and Shubham Sahoo. "Online Examination System Using Django." International Journal of Creative and Open Research in Engineering and Management, vol. 02, no. 6, 2026, pp. . doi:https://doi.org/10.55041/ijcope.v2i6.085.
Rout, Mahaprasad, and Shubham Sahoo. "Online Examination System Using Django." International Journal of Creative and Open Research in Engineering and Management 02, no. 6 (2026). https://doi.org/https://doi.org/10.55041/ijcope.v2i6.085.
References
- W3Schools Online Web Tutorials, Available at: https://www.w3schools.com/
- Bootstrap Documentation, Available at: https://getbootstrap.com/
- Oracle Corporation, MySQL Documentation, Available at: https://dev.mysql.com/doc/
- Gupta, R., Sharma, P., and Singh, A., “Online Home Service Management System,” International Journal of Computer Applications, 145, No. 6, pp. 15–20, 2016.
- Kumar, and Reddy, V., “Service Booking and Provider Management Using Web Technologies,” International Journal of Advanced Research in Computer Science, Vol. 8, No. 4, pp. 220–225, 2017.
- Patel, H., Shah, M., and Joshi, R., “Web-Based Service Provider Platform Using Django Framework,” International Research Journal of Engineering and
Ethical Compliance & Review Process
- •All submissions are screened under plagiarism detection.
- •Review follows editorial policy.
- •Authors retain copyright.
- •Peer Review Type: Double-Blind Peer Review
- •Published on: Jun 06 2026
This article is licensed under a Creative Commons Attribution-NonCommercial 4.0 International License. You are free to share and adapt this work for non-commercial purposes with proper attribution.

